I've been thinking that my Blaze is not calculating my steps correctly.  So today I tested against two other GPS enabled applications.  These are the results from each testing: 

 

Fitbit  3,672 steps  1.35 miles

S Health  4,961 steps  2.0 miles

MapMyWalk  5,111 steps 2.1 miles   

 

That's a huge difference from my Fitbit to either of those.  Is my Fitbit not working correctly?

Great to see you around @BarbYork and @Rich_Laue thanks for stopping by and the recommendation. Woman Wink Actually, I agree with our friend here. Please do the following:

 

1. Put your tracker on your wrist.
2. Walk 100 steps, making sure to count a step each time one of your feet hits the ground.
3. Pause, then check your tracker to see your step count.

 

If you think that the amount of steps is really inaccurate, feel free to contact our support team, since they have the proper tools to see the information that your tracker is registering. For a faster response you can contact them via phone or chat.
